复制
收藏
提问
全网

linux系统中,如何设置系统环境变量

def0b92a5
3个月前
全网
文档
学术
百科
知识库
时间不限
自动
回答简洁
更专业一些

在Linux系统中设置环境变量可以通过多种方式完成,以下是一些常见的方法:

  1. 临时设置环境变量: 使用export命令可以在当前终端会话中设置环境变量。例如,设置PATH环境变量:

    export PATH=$PATH:/your/new/path
    
  2. 永久设置环境变量: 要永久设置环境变量,可以将它们添加到用户的shell配置文件中,如.bashrc.profile.bash_profile等。例如:

    echo 'export PATH=$PATH:/your/new/path' >> ~/.bashrc
    

    然后,运行source ~/.bashrc来使更改生效。

  3. 全局设置环境变量: 对于所有用户,可以将环境变量添加到/etc/profile/etc/environment文件中。这通常需要管理员权限:

    sudo echo 'export PATH=$PATH:/your/new/path' >> /etc/profile
    

    然后,所有用户在登录时都会加载这些环境变量。

  4. 使用set命令set命令可以用于查看、设置和删除环境变量。例如,设置环境变量:

    set PATH=$PATH:/your/new/path
    
  5. 使用env命令env命令可以用于查看当前的环境变量,但它不能直接设置环境变量。但是,你可以使用它来启动一个新会话,其中包含特定的环境变量:

    env PATH=$PATH:/your/new/path /bin/bash
    
  6. 使用/etc/environment文件: 在某些Linux发行版中,/etc/environment文件用于设置系统级别的环境变量。编辑此文件可以设置全局环境变量:

    sudo nano /etc/environment
    

    在文件中添加如下行:

    PATH="/your/new/path:$PATH"
    

请注意,对于某些环境变量,如PATH,通常建议添加到现有的路径中,而不是替换它。这样可以确保系统和应用程序仍然可以找到它们需要的可执行文件。

推荐追问
Linux环境变量设置方法
如何在Linux中添加环境变量
Linux系统环境变量的作用
如何在Linux中修改环境变量
Linux环境变量的优先级
Linux环境变量的类型有哪些

以上内容由AI搜集生成,仅供参考

在线客服